SIIG cards and puc



I've tried to get one of the 20x family 16C650 64-byte buffer SIIG cards to
work. It does not work out of the box.

I had to add 0x40000001 into the flags in pucdata.c for my card and "options
COM_MULTIPORT" into the kernel config. It's still limited to 115200 baud, but
all I was interested is 9600 anyway.

Can this be implemented into the source tree ?
